Bonjour,
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ille 1) dans laquelle se trouve une base de données sous forme de tableau contenant le nom de l’aliment ainsi que sur la même ligne les valeurs en protéines, glucides etc…
Je souhaite dans une autre feuille (feuille 2) lorsque je tape l’aliment (grace à une liste déroulante contenant les aliments de la base de données) ainsi que sa quantité, que les composants (proteines, lipides etc…) soient calculés automatiquement.
Pour cela j’ai donc créer une fonction si avec les paramètres suivant:
F6 : la quantité de l’aliment sur la feuille 2
F18:L18 : tout le tableau de la base de données de la feuille 1
Du coup voici ma fonction si :
=SI((F6*F18:L18/100)<>0;F6*F18:L18/100; ““)
Cette formule fonctionne très bien pour la première ligne du tableau sur ma feuille 2 .
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ment et indiquer les quantités, les résultats des opérations pour tous les composant ne s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ve pas la solution …
Je sais pas d’où cela pourrait venir, sûrement que ma formule n’est pas correcte ou alors que je n’utilise pas la bonne.
J’espère m’être bien exprimer sur mon problème.
Merci d’avance
Bien cordialement.
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
MichD
Le 09/09/21 Í 08:01, luciegh a écrit :
Bonjour,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ille 1) dans laquelle se trouve une base de données sous forme de tableau contenant le nom de l’aliment ainsi que sur la même ligne les valeurs en protéines, glucides etc… Je souhaite dans une autre feuille (feuille 2) lorsque je tape l’aliment (grace Í une liste déroulante contenant les aliments de la base de données) ainsi que sa quantité, que les composants (proteines, lipides etc…) soient calculés automatiquement. Pour cela j’ai donc créer une fonction si avec les paramètres suivant: F6 : la quantité de l’aliment sur la feuille 2 F18:L18 : tout le tableau de la base de données de la feuille 1 Du coup voici ma fonction si : =SI((F6*F18:L18/100)<>0;F6*F18:L18/100; ““) Cette formule fonctionne très bien pour la première ligne du tableau sur ma feuille 2 .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ment et indiquer les quantités, les résultats des opérations pour tous les composant ne s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ve pas la solution … Je sais pas d’o͹ cela pourrait venir, sÍ»rement que ma formule n’est pas correcte ou alors que je n’utilise pas la bonne. J’espère m’être bien exprimer sur mon problème. Merci d’avance Bien cordialement.
Bonjour, Peux-tu publier un exemplaire réduit qu'Í 5 ou 6 lignes de données sur les 2 feuilles (ces données peuvent être fictives si nécessaire) afin de voir la disposition ... N'oublie pas de mentionner le résultat attendu pour chacune des lignes. L'adresse Í utiliser : Cjoint.com Tu obtiendras une adresse que tu publies ici. MichD
Le 09/09/21 Í 08:01, luciegh a écrit :
Bonjour,
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ille 1) dans
laquelle se trouve une base de données sous forme de tableau contenant le nom de
l’aliment ainsi que sur la même ligne les valeurs en protéines, glucides etc…
Je souhaite dans une autre feuille (feuille 2) lorsque je tape l’aliment (grace
Í une liste déroulante contenant les aliments de la base de données) ainsi que
sa quantité, que les composants (proteines, lipides etc…) soient calculés
automatiquement.
Pour cela j’ai donc créer une fonction si avec les paramètres suivant:
F6 : la quantité de l’aliment sur la feuille 2
F18:L18 : tout le tableau de la base de données de la feuille 1
Du coup voici ma fonction si :
=SI((F6*F18:L18/100)<>0;F6*F18:L18/100;Â ““)
Cette formule fonctionne très bien pour la première ligne du tableau sur ma
feuille 2 .
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ment et
indiquer les quantités, les résultats des opérations pour tous les composant ne
s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ve pas
la solution …
Je sais pas d’o͹ cela pourrait venir, sÍ»rement que ma formule n’est pas correcte
ou alors que je n’utilise pas la bonne.
J’espère m’être bien exprimer sur mon problème.
Merci d’avance
Bien cordialement.
Bonjour,
Peux-tu publier un exemplaire réduit qu'Í 5 ou 6 lignes de données sur
les 2 feuilles (ces données peuvent être fictives si nécessaire) afin de
voir la disposition ... N'oublie pas de mentionner le résultat attendu
pour chacune des lignes.
Bonjour,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ille 1) dans laquelle se trouve une base de données sous forme de tableau contenant le nom de l’aliment ainsi que sur la même ligne les valeurs en protéines, glucides etc… Je souhaite dans une autre feuille (feuille 2) lorsque je tape l’aliment (grace Í une liste déroulante contenant les aliments de la base de données) ainsi que sa quantité, que les composants (proteines, lipides etc…) soient calculés automatiquement. Pour cela j’ai donc créer une fonction si avec les paramètres suivant: F6 : la quantité de l’aliment sur la feuille 2 F18:L18 : tout le tableau de la base de données de la feuille 1 Du coup voici ma fonction si : =SI((F6*F18:L18/100)<>0;F6*F18:L18/100; ““) Cette formule fonctionne très bien pour la première ligne du tableau sur ma feuille 2 .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ment et indiquer les quantités, les résultats des opérations pour tous les composant ne s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ve pas la solution … Je sais pas d’o͹ cela pourrait venir, sÍ»rement que ma formule n’est pas correcte ou alors que je n’utilise pas la bonne. J’espère m’être bien exprimer sur mon problème. Merci d’avance Bien cordialement.
Bonjour, Peux-tu publier un exemplaire réduit qu'Í 5 ou 6 lignes de données sur les 2 feuilles (ces données peuvent être fictives si nécessaire) afin de voir la disposition ... N'oublie pas de mentionner le résultat attendu pour chacune des lignes. L'adresse Í utiliser : Cjoint.com Tu obtiendras une adresse que tu publies ici. MichD
luciegh
Le jeudi 09 Septembre 2021 à 14:49 par MichD :
Le 09/09/21 Í 08:01, luciegh a écrit :
Bonjour,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ille 1) dans laquelle se trouve une base de données sous forme de tableau contenant le nom de l’aliment ainsi que sur la même ligne les valeurs en protéines, glucides etc… Je souhaite dans une autre feuille (feuille 2) lorsque je tape l’aliment (grace Í une liste déroulante contenant les aliments de la base de données) ainsi que sa quantité, que les composants (proteines, lipides etc…) soient calculés automatiquement. Pour cela j’ai donc créer une fonction si avec les paramètres suivant: F6 : la quantité de l’aliment sur la feuille 2 F18:L18 : tout le tableau de la base de données de la feuille 1 Du coup voici ma fonction si : =SI((F6*F18:L18/100)<>0;F6*F18:L18/100; ““) Cette formule fonctionne très bien pour la première ligne du tableau sur ma feuille 2 .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ment et indiquer les quantités, les résultats des opérations pour tous les composant ne s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ve pas la solution … Je sais pas d’o͹ cela pourrait venir, sÍ»rement que ma formule n’est pas correcte ou alors que je n’utilise pas la bonne. J’espère m’être bien exprimer sur mon problème. Merci d’avance Bien cordialement.
Bonjour, Peux-tu publier un exemplaire réduit qu'Í 5 ou 6 lignes de données sur les 2 feuilles (ces données peuvent être fictives si nécessaire) afin de voir la disposition ... N'oublie pas de mentionner le résultat attendu pour chacune des lignes. L'adresse Í utiliser : Cjoint.com Tu obtiendras une adresse que tu publies ici. MichD
bonjour, merci pour votre réponse, sauf que je n'ai pas très bien compris comment publier un exemplaire ? merci encore ^^
Le jeudi 09 Septembre 2021 à 14:49 par MichD :
> Le 09/09/21 Í 08:01, luciegh a écrit :
>> Bonjour,
>>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ille
>> 1) dans
>> laquelle se trouve une base de données sous forme de tableau contenant
>> le nom de
>> l’aliment ainsi que sur la même ligne les valeurs en
>> protéines, glucides etc…
>> Je souhaite dans une autre feuille (feuille 2) lorsque je tape
>> l’aliment (grace
>> Í une liste déroulante contenant les aliments de la base
>> de données) ainsi que
>> sa quantité, que les composants (proteines, lipides etc…) soient
>> calculés
>> automatiquement.
>> Pour cela j’ai donc créer une fonction si avec les
>> paramètres suivant:
>> F6 : la quantité de l’aliment sur la feuille 2
>> F18:L18 : tout le tableau de la base de données de la feuille 1
>>
>> Du coup voici ma fonction si :
>> =SI((F6*F18:L18/100)<>0;F6*F18:L18/100;Â ““)
>>
>> Cette formule fonctionne très bien pour la première ligne du
>> tableau sur ma
>> feuille 2 .
>>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ment
>> et
>> indiquer les quantités, les résultats des opérations pour
>> tous les composant ne
>> s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ve
>> pas
>> la solution …
>>
>> Je sais pas d’o͹ cela pourrait venir,
>> sÍ»rement que ma formule n’est pas correcte
>> ou alors que je n’utilise pas la bonne.
>>
>> J’espère m’être bien exprimer sur mon
>> problème.
>> Merci d’avance
>> Bien cordialement.
>>
>>
>>
> Bonjour,
>
> Peux-tu publier un exemplaire réduit qu'Í 5 ou 6 lignes de
> données sur
> les 2 feuilles (ces données peuvent être fictives si
> nécessaire) afin de
> voir la disposition ... N'oublie pas de mentionner le résultat attendu
> pour chacune des lignes.
>
> L'adresse Í utiliser : Cjoint.com
>
> Tu obtiendras une adresse que tu publies ici.
>
> MichD
bonjour,
merci pour votre réponse, sauf que je n'ai pas très bien compris comment publier un exemplaire ?
merci encore ^^
Bonjour, Dans le cadre de mon travail, j’ai crée un feuille Excel (feuille 1) dans laquelle se trouve une base de données sous forme de tableau contenant le nom de l’aliment ainsi que sur la même ligne les valeurs en protéines, glucides etc… Je souhaite dans une autre feuille (feuille 2) lorsque je tape l’aliment (grace Í une liste déroulante contenant les aliments de la base de données) ainsi que sa quantité, que les composants (proteines, lipides etc…) soient calculés automatiquement. Pour cela j’ai donc créer une fonction si avec les paramètres suivant: F6 : la quantité de l’aliment sur la feuille 2 F18:L18 : tout le tableau de la base de données de la feuille 1 Du coup voici ma fonction si : =SI((F6*F18:L18/100)<>0;F6*F18:L18/100; ““) Cette formule fonctionne très bien pour la première ligne du tableau sur ma feuille 2 . Mais lorsque je souhaite passer sur la prochaine ligne choisir l’aliment et indiquer les quantités, les résultats des opérations pour tous les composant ne sont pas correctes. Cela fait un moment que je bute dessus mais je ne trouve pas la solution … Je sais pas d’o͹ cela pourrait venir, sÍ»rement que ma formule n’est pas correcte ou alors que je n’utilise pas la bonne. J’espère m’être bien exprimer sur mon problème. Merci d’avance Bien cordialement.
Bonjour, Peux-tu publier un exemplaire réduit qu'Í 5 ou 6 lignes de données sur les 2 feuilles (ces données peuvent être fictives si nécessaire) afin de voir la disposition ... N'oublie pas de mentionner le résultat attendu pour chacune des lignes. L'adresse Í utiliser : Cjoint.com Tu obtiendras une adresse que tu publies ici. MichD
bonjour, merci pour votre réponse, sauf que je n'ai pas très bien compris comment publier un exemplaire ? merci encore ^^